Ilocano[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From Proto-Philippine *bəŋat (to state) (cf. Cebuano bungat, Hiligaynon bungat).

Pronunciation[edit]

  • Hyphenation: beng‧ngát
  • (northern Ilocano) IPA(key): /bɛŋˈŋat/
  • (southern Ilocano) IPA(key): /bɯŋˈŋat/

Noun[edit]

bengngát

  1. (linguistics, sociolinguistics) accent
  2. stock phrase
